Fortnite v42.10 adds new Sprites and Big Head mode

Fortnite Chapter 7 Season 4 has received its first update, v42.10. The patch adds new loot, Sprites and match overrides across Battle Royale, while Fortnite OG and LEGO Fortnite Odyssey also receive substantial changes.

What is included in the Fortnite v42.10 update?

The Battle Royale island now has several weapons available as loot hacks. These include the Caduceus Staff from Overwatch, Scorpion’s Combat Kit from Mortal Kombat, the Wrecker Revolver, the Deadeye Assault Rifle and the Holo Twister Assault Rifle.

Because they are loot hacks, these weapons can be unlocked with Sprite Dust. Their arrival is expected to influence how players approach matches and build their loadouts.

Four new Sprites

The update also introduces four Sprites: Onigiri, X-Ray, Mega Man and Overshield. These additions bring new options to the island and may prove just as significant to match strategy as the new weapons.

Three match overrides

Players can activate three new match overrides during games:

  • Big Head: Every player’s head becomes much larger, giving the match a deliberately retro-styled visual twist.
  • Prop Hunt: Crouching and remaining still turns a player into a prop.
  • Action Hero: Players can enter hangtime while aiming down sights in mid-air.

LEGO Fortnite Odyssey gets a Batman event

lego batman by the batmobile in fortnite

The update extends beyond Battle Royale. Fortnite OG now has a new Battle Pass based on Chapter 1 Season X, while LEGO Fortnite Odyssey receives a large Batman-themed event.

New journal missions send players after stolen parts of Gotham City hidden around the LEGO Fortnite Odyssey island. The Bat Signal points towards Gotham City locations, where players must defeat henchmen while helping Batman recover what was taken.

Players can use Batman equipment during the event, including the Batmobile, which should make travelling around the island easier. The event runs until 15 October, after which LEGO Batman can be recruited as a villager.

The current LEGO Fortnite Pass has been extended until 31 October, so the next pass will not be Batman-themed. The Batman Caped Crusader pack is scheduled to return on 17 September, offering another way to add matching cosmetics to the event.
